About A. Peretto

A. Peretto is a scholar working on Energy Engineering and Power Technology, Mechanical Engineering and Statistical and Nonlinear Physics, having authored 113 papers that have together received 1.7k indexed citations. Recurring topics across this work include Thermodynamic and Exergetic Analyses of Power and Cooling Systems (60 papers), Turbomachinery Performance and Optimization (23 papers), Refrigeration and Air Conditioning Technologies (20 papers), Advanced Thermodynamics and Statistical Mechanics (20 papers), Combustion and flame dynamics (17 papers), Advanced Thermodynamic Systems and Engines (15 papers), Advanced Aircraft Design and Technologies (12 papers) and Integrated Energy Systems Optimization (11 papers). The work is most often cited by research in Energy Engineering and Power Technology (185 citations), Statistical and Nonlinear Physics (366 citations) and Mechanical Engineering (990 citations). A. Peretto has collaborated with scholars based in Italy, United States and France. Frequent co-authors include M. Bianchi, Andrea De Pascale, F. Melino, Lisa Branchini, Rakesh Bhargava, Pier Ruggero Spina, Maria Alessandra Ancona, Mustapha Chaker, Cyrus B. Meher-Homji and Mario Paolone. Their work appears in journals such as Journal of Engineering for Gas Turbines and Power, Applied Energy, Energy Conversion and Management, Energy and Applied Thermal Engineering.
